The Opportunity
We're seeking for a Data Analyst who can transform our differentiated dataset into authoritative insights that shape industry narratives and drive media coverage.
What You'll Do
You'll analyze global freight patterns to identify emerging trends and disruptions—then translate those findings into reports and media responses that journalists, executives, and industry analysts rely on. Your work directly drives our media strategy: data-driven insights currently account for 40% of unearned media at project44 and are critical to maintaining our leadership position in share of voice against competitors.
Your work breaks into two categories:
- Real-time crisis reporting: Rapid analysis of breaking events like the Panama Canal drought, Baltimore bridge collapse, and Red Sea diversions—providing immediate context on supply chain impacts
- Predictable, repeatable reporting: Monthly tariff impact analyses and bi-annual deep dives on peak season last-mile dynamics and ocean transit conditions
Key Responsibilities
- Query and analyze datasets spanning ocean, air, parcel, and ground networks to identify meaningful patterns in transit times, capacity constraints, port operations, and freight flows
- Monitor geopolitical events, weather disruptions, labor actions, and policy changes to rapidly assess supply chain impacts—then explain the "why" behind the data to external audiences
- Write clear, data-driven reports that communicate complex findings to media, customers, and industry stakeholders
- Respond to journalist inquiries with quick-turnaround analysis and context, providing expert commentary backed by our proprietary data
- Conduct media interviews to provide deeper insight into trends and breaking supply chain events
- Collaborate with a network of friendly reporters who regularly leverage our insights for their coverage
- Validate data quality and methodology to ensure analytical integrity and credibility
- Create compelling visualizations that make insights immediately accessible
